The BlackBerry® Tour™ smartphone has a full QWERTY keyboard and thus will allow a speed dial for each key. This means you have up to 26 different speed dials that you can save as opposed to 10 on a normal phone.
If you also notice, the numbers on the keyboard coincide with letters, thus you can still feel like you're using the numbers 1-9 by setting up the speed dials for each of the letters on those keys. To make it simpler, hold down a letter from the home screen, if it doesn't already have a speed dial number associated, it will ask you if you want to add one to it!
